NFC East Blog: Are the Titans finished?

by Bill Young

The Tennessee Titans just lost a game to a team that got utterly humiliated the week before, the Washington Redskins. Randy Moss was ineffective and Vince Young had another tantrum. At a certain point, should coach Jeff Fisher just get rid of Vince Young for good and start over? Start Kerry Collins when healthy or another available veteran QB like Jeff Garcia. Even Daunte Culpepper would be a step in the right direction.
Vince Young is clearly a head case who is not mentally tough. He is the definition of a player Fisher can't tolerate. Forget about Randy Moss being a distraction. He provided holes for others to take advantage of. The playcalling, however, was atrocious. Probowl RB Chris Johnson did not get enough carries against the Redskins.
How did the Redskins hold down the league's top scoring offense to 16 points? Simple. Cover the stars and let such great players like Bo Scaife win the game. The Titans have to be able to throw on early downs so that a team like the Redskins can't always load the box. If not, audibles must be made to get a running play to go away from the blitz. Veteran QBs should be able to make these calls at the line. Unfortunately, Vince Young doesn't appear to fit that mold just yet.
